With experience and knowledge across a diverse array of renewable energy assets, the energy and natural resources team at Morais Leitão, Galvão Teles, Soares da Silva & Associados boasts wide-ranging capabilities across transactional, licensing, and project development mandates. Catarina Brito Ferreira provides ‘extensive technical and legal knowledge in the energy sector’, acting for clients on M&A, regulatory, and licensing matters concerning wind, solar, and power-to-X projects. Ricardo Andrade Amaro is a corporate and commercial law expert, with a long track record of advising power companies on renewable energy M&A, tender processes, and power purchase agreements.
